"Spoonie Press champions work for and by chronically ill, neurodivergent, and disabled individuals (affectionately called #spoonies). Spoonie Journal is a bi-annual print/digital publication."

Active on social media Accept previously published Available in print Offer expedited response: $3 - 72 hour response, $5 - 1 week response with developmental feedback, $10 - 72 hour response with developmental feedback Promote writers even after publication - hype hype hype Work for and by chronically ill, neurodivergent, and disabled individuals
